Chelsea ace Eden Hazard has set a deadline for his move to Real Madrid to be completed.
The Mirror says the Chelsea star has set a deadline of June 4 for his future to be resolved, with Real poised to firm up their long-held interest in the Belgian with a solid bid for his services.
However, the clubs are still some £26million apart in their valuation of the 28-year-old, with Real so far offering £86million and Chelsea looking for something closer to £112million.
A compromise is expected to be reached, with Hazard almost certain to be swapping Stamford Bridge for the Santiago Bernabeu this summer.
But it is believed that he has told friends that he wants the deal to be in place before he joins up with the Belgium squad for their Euro 2020 qualifiers with Kazakhstan on June 8 and Scotland on June 11.
